Lamb & Rich: 60 Forest Drive, c. 1888

Photograph
Unnumbered Hartshorn House Colonial Revival style with gambrel roof. Oversize. Exterior finish is stone and clapboard. Note the ornament in the brick chimney; the curved pattern of shingles between 3rd floor windows; the roof brackets. The house is drastically altered by removal of porch. House for Stewart Hartshorn at 60 Forest Drive (George H. Rosé House), Short Hills, N.J.,1888, L.&R.

David Gibson Historic Sites Survey 1978
